District Overview
Located at 2002 E. Baseline Rd. in Phoenix, Arizona, the Arizona Agribusiness & Equine Center Inc. operates as an open, independent public charter district tailored specifically for high school students. Set within a bustling large city environment in the Phoenix-Mesa-Chandler metropolitan area, this single-school district provides focused secondary education serving grades 9 through 12. Functioning as an independent local education agency, the district blends rigorous high school academics with specialized learning pathways, offering a dedicated educational setting for students preparing for post-secondary education and technical careers.
During the 2024–2025 academic year, the district serves a total enrollment of 426 high school students, distributed across 92 ninth graders, 130 tenth graders, 101 eleventh graders, and 103 seniors. The student population represents a diverse community—predominantly composed of Hispanic students (379), along with Black (22), White (16), American Indian (3), Asian (3), and multiracial (3) students, with a gender breakdown of 252 female and 174 male learners. To foster individualized instruction and close academic mentorship, the district employs a robust instructional workforce consisting of 40 full-time equivalent (FTE) teachers and 2 support staff members, yielding an advantageous student-to-teacher ratio of approximately 11 to 1.
